Emily Carrasco
Seattle, WA
Emily approaches every project with a keen sensitivity to context, thoughtfully considering site history, cultural relevance, and community identity while prioritizing the comfort, wellness, and experience of building occupants.
Since beginning her career in 2007, Emily has cultivated deep expertise in lighting design and controls, establishing herself as a trusted expert known for delivering thoughtful and impactful design solutions. As the Principal Lighting Designer at Delta E, she leads with a deep understanding of both architectural lighting design and advanced lighting controls. She plays a pivotal role in Delta E's holistic design approach, and her work is guided by a strong commitment to integrating energy efficiency, code compliance, and budget-conscious strategies without sacrificing the artistic and emotional impact of light. Her designs consistently reflect a balance of aesthetic goals, constructability and budget—illuminating spaces in ways that are both innovative and grounded in purpose. Emily’s dedication to excellence and hands-on involvement have earned her numerous awards.
